Slumdog Millionaire. Yeah, so it won pretty much every award it was nominated for. Can't say I'm not surprised. I'm not sure why this movie has gotten so much attention, honestly. Either way, I'm glad to see Benjamin Button picking up a couple for its outstanding effects and makeup, and I'm definitely happy to see Wall-E take best animated feature. Also, for those of you that actually care, for whatever reason, I've listed and linked the rest of the winners (or should I say the rest of the Oscars Slumdog Millionaire won) to their prospective IMDB pages.
